hmmm...i7-4702u or i7-4702mq? Not suppose to be this processor 4th Generation Intel Core i7-4700MQ Processor (3.40 GHz 400 MHz 6 MB)? blink.gif
*
the best i7 ULV you can get at the moment is i7-4500U.
there is no such processor, i7-4702U in Haswell lineup. so it is confirmed either i7-4702HQ/MQ

to add, i7-4702MQ/HQ is an undervolted version of i7-4700MQ/HQ

FYI, the difference between i7-4700MQ and i7-4500U is the MQ is a quad core high performance processor and the U is an ultra-low voltage dual processor. the U is weaker than the MQ a lot but saves battery life more than the MQ.

all the laptops you listed do come with Optimus but Optimus dont really help much IMO. they only save about 20% of the tested battery life on usages.
